package gnu.classpath.examples.midi;

import java.awt.*;
import java.awt.event.*;
import java.util.*;
import javax.sound.midi.*;

/**
 * An example how javax.sound.midi facilities work.
 */
public class Demo extends Frame implements ItemListener
{
  Choice midiInChoice = new Choice();
  Choice midiOutChoice = new Choice();

  MidiDevice inDevice = null;
  MidiDevice outDevice = null;

  ArrayList inDevices = new ArrayList();
  ArrayList outDevices = new ArrayList();

  public Demo () throws Exception
  {
    MenuBar mb = new MenuBar ();
    Menu menu = new Menu ("File");
    MenuItem quit = new MenuItem("Quit", new MenuShortcut('Q'));
    quit.addActionListener(new ActionListener()
      {
        public void actionPerformed(ActionEvent e)
        {
          System.exit(0);
        }
      });
    menu.add (quit);
    mb.add(menu);

    setTitle("synthcity: the GNU Classpath MIDI Demo");
    setLayout(new FlowLayout());

    MidiDevice.Info[] infos = MidiSystem.getMidiDeviceInfo();

    for (int i = 0; i < infos.length; i++)
      {
        MidiDevice device = MidiSystem.getMidiDevice(infos[i]);
        if (device.getMaxReceivers() > 0)
          {
            midiOutChoice.addItem(infos[i].getDescription());
            outDevices.add(device);
          }
        if (device.getMaxTransmitters() > 0)
          {
            midiInChoice.addItem(infos[i].getDescription());
            inDevices.add(device);
          }
      }

    setMenuBar (mb);
    add(new Label("MIDI IN: "));
    add(midiInChoice);
    add(new Label("   MIDI OUT: "));
    add(midiOutChoice);

    midiInChoice.addItemListener(this);
    midiOutChoice.addItemListener(this);

    pack();
    show();
  }

  public void itemStateChanged (ItemEvent e)
  {
    try
      {
        if (e.getItemSelectable() == midiInChoice)
          {
            if (inDevice != null)
              inDevice.close();
            inDevice =  (MidiDevice)
              inDevices.get(midiInChoice.getSelectedIndex());
          }

        if (e.getItemSelectable() == midiOutChoice)
          {
            if (outDevice != null)
              outDevice.close();
            outDevice = (MidiDevice)
              outDevices.get(midiOutChoice.getSelectedIndex());
          }

        if (inDevice != null && outDevice != null)
          {
            if (! inDevice.isOpen())
              inDevice.open();
            if (! outDevice.isOpen())
              outDevice.open();
            Transmitter t = inDevice.getTransmitter();
            if (t == null)
              System.err.println (inDevice + ".getTransmitter() == null");
            Receiver r = outDevice.getReceiver();
            if (r == null)
              System.err.println (outDevice + ".getReceiver() == null");

            if (t != null && r != null)
              t.setReceiver (r);
          }
      }
    catch (Exception ex)
      {
        ex.printStackTrace();
      }
  }

  public static void main (String args[]) throws Exception
    {
      new Demo();
    }
}
